怎么在unity中让模型外发光?(武器发光shader)

为和为和 攻略大全 2025-05-10 22:43:34 52 0
  1. 怎么在unity中让模型外发光?
  2. sp自发光材质如何调出来?

怎么在unity中让模型外发光?

1. 创建一个有颜色的发光效果的材质。可以使用unity或其他游戏引擎提供的发光材质,或者自定义一个材质。确保材质的颜色和亮度适合你想要的效果。

2. 创建一个发光对象,可以是一个球体、立方体或者其他形状。将发光材质应用到该对象上。

怎么在unity中让模型外发光?(武器发光shader)

3. 将发光对象放置在场景中,使其与你想要发光的物体接触或者靠近。

4. 调整发光对象的大小和位置,使其只发光在你想要的局部区域。

5. 根据需要,可以调整发光对象的强度、范围和颜色等属性,以达到最理想的效果。

怎么在unity中让模型外发光?(武器发光shader)

1 在Unity中,可以通过使用shader来实现模型外发光效果。
2 外发光效果可以通过在模型的材质上应用自定义的Shader,该Shader可以通过在模型表面添加一个发光效果的纹理来实现。
3 通过调整Shader中的参数,可以控制外发光的强度、颜色和范围等属性,从而实现不同的外发光效果。
4 此外,还可以通过在场景中添加光源来增强模型的外发光效果,例如在模型周围放置一个点光源或者聚光灯。
5 外发光效果可以为模型增添视觉上的吸引力,并且在游戏中可以用于突出重要物体或者营造特殊的氛围。

要在Unity中让模型外发光,可以使用Shader来实现。首先,在Shader中使用Emission属性来设置模型的发光颜色和强度,然后将其应用到模型的材质上。

接着,在光源的脚本中,将光源的颜色设置为与模型的发光颜色相同,并在光源的范围内启用Shadow Casting。这样,当模型与光源相交时,模型就会发出光芒。

怎么在unity中让模型外发光?(武器发光shader)

最后,将光源放置在场景中适当的位置,就可以实现模型的外发光效果了。

sp自发光材质如何调出来?

sp自发光材质可以通过以下步骤进行调出:
结论:通过Shader Graph中的自发光节点调出sp自发光材质。
解释原因:自发光节点是Shader Graph中的一种节点,通过在该节点上调整参数,可以实现自发光材质。
同时,sp自发光材质也是一种自发光效果,可以通过调整其参数来实现不同的效果。
内容延伸:除了自发光节点外,Shader Graph中还有很多其它类型的节点,例如贴图节点、数学节点等等,这些节点可以相互连接,实现更加复杂的材质效果。
在使用Shader Graph时,需要结合具体应用场景和需求,选择合适的节点和参数来进行调整,从而达到理想的效果。

回答如下:要创建一个sp自发光材质,可以按照以下步骤:

1. 在Unity中创建一个新的材质。

2. 在材质属性中,选择“Standard”着色器。

3. 在“Standard”着色器属性中,找到“Emission”属性,并将其值设置为所需的自发光颜色。

4. 还可以调整“Emission”属性的强度,以控制自发光的亮度。

5. 若要在场景中使用这个自发光材质,可以将其分配给一个对象的渲染器组件。

6. 如果需要在脚本中动态调整自发光材质的颜色和强度,可以通过获取渲染器组件的材质属性来实现。

例如,以下代码可以改变渲染器组件的自发光颜色:

```

Renderer renderer = GetComponent<Renderer>();

到此,以上就是小编对于武器发光的手游的问题就介绍到这了,希望介绍的2点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。

文章目录